The Strategic Significance of Bonuses in Digital Casinos
Bonuses serve multiple functions within the online casino ecosystem. From a marketing standpoint, they act as compelling hooks that differentiate platforms in a saturated market. According to recent industry reports, over 85% of licensed online casinos in the UK offer some form of bonus, reflecting their status as a core engagement tool (Gambling Law Review, 2023).
From the player’s perspective, bonuses can enhance value by increasing deposit limits, extending gameplay, and providing free opportunities to explore new games without substantial financial risk. Yet, the allure of bonus offers often comes with conditions—wagering requirements, restrictions on withdrawal, and game-specific rules—that can devalue initial marketing promises if not clearly articulated.
| Bonus Type | Description | Typical Conditions |
|---|---|---|
| Welcome Bonus | Given to new players on initial deposit to incentivise registration. | Wagering requirements, expiry periods. |
| No Deposit Bonus | Free spins or credits awarded without deposit, ideal for risk-free exploration. | Limited amount, restrictions on withdrawal. |
| Reload Bonus | Issued on subsequent deposits to encourage continued engagement. | Associated with deposit minimums, wagering stipulations. |
Balancing Promotional Pursuits and Responsible Gaming
While bonuses are undeniably effective, industry leaders and regulators recognise their potential for encouraging problematic behaviours. The UK’s Gambling Commission has thus emphasised transparency and consumer protection, urging operators to clearly communicate bonus terms (UK Gambling Commission Regulations, 2022).
In this context, savvy players are increasingly discerning, often scrutinising bonus restrictions before committing their funds. This dynamic underscores a broader shift: bonuses are no longer just promotional tools but integral elements of responsible gaming policies that foster trust and long-term engagement.
